FOOTBALL: Indians take command of SIRR Mississippi

DU QUOIN, IL - Du Quoin running back Shayne Baxter ran for 165 yards and 4 touchdowns in addition to grabbing an interception on defense as the Indians took over sole possession of first place in the SIRR Mississippi Division with a 35-20 win over Carterville on Friday night at Van Metre Field.

Both teams topped 300 total yards of offense in the game, but Du Quoin's defense created the game's only turnover and got a huge stop in the third quarter which led to a two-score advantage.

Baxter picked off Lions' quarterback Michael Aschemann on the game's opening drive after Carterville had driven inside Du Quoin territory. The drive that followed by the Indians ate up 9 minutes of game clock on 19 plays from scrimmage and included three fourth-down conversions by the Du Quoin offense. DHS led 7-0 after a 5-yard TD run by Baxter just seconds into the second quarter.

The Lions answered with a time-consuming possession of their own. After taking over on their own 24, Aschemann and fullback Phillip Frangello (15 carries, 105) led Carterville on a 14-play drive capped off by Aschemann's 7-yard TD. Du Quoin's Deeja Cole blocked the extra point, however, and the Indians still led 7-6.

Keeping with the theme of long, grind-it-out drives, Du Quoin started at their own 40 with 6:25 to go in the half and again pounded their way downfield.

Baxter went in untouched on the drive's fifteenth play with 36 seconds on the clock, a 2-yard rush on a pitch from quarterback Brenden Fred, and the Indians led 14-6 at the break.

With a chance to go up two touchdowns, Du Quoin turned the ball over on downs on their first possession out of the locker rooms. The Indians' defense, which was ran on for much of the night, then came up with three big stops to force a three-and-out punt - the only punt of the ball game.

Baxter and Cole carried the load for Du Quoin on a 51-yard scoring drive as the Indians pushed ahead 21-6 with 3:03 left in the third on Baxter's third TD.

Frangello broke a 39-yard TD run for the Lions before the end of the period, but Baxter's fourth TD, this one from 8 yards out, restored the Indians' 15-point cushion.

Aschemann aired it out on the next drive, connecting with Dalton Brown for a 67-yard touchdown pass, but Carterville still couldn't find a way to stop Du Quoin's offense.

Fred finished off the last scoring drive of the game with a 29-yard pass in the corner of the end zone to Travis Chapman, putting the game away with 2:19 remaining.

Fred completed 9-of-12 throws on the night for 142 yards in addition to 38 rushing yards on 8 attempts. Daulton Donoghue led in receiving with 3 catches for 54 yards with Chapman (1-29), Cole (1-9), Baxter (2-15) and John Erwin (2-36) also grabbing passes.

Cole (9 carries, 25 yards) and Jonah Spencer (4-18) combined with Fred and Baxter for Du Quoin's 246 rushing yards against Carterville.

Aschemann was 5-for-10 passing with 101 yards and ran for 48 yards on 14 carries.

Du Quoin (4-2, 3-0) travels to Pinckneyville (2-4, 0-3) in week seven.
